Do not wear badly worn shoes while exercising. Shoes that are old and worn out do not distribute your weight evenly. They can also known for other problems in your joints and legs. If you see uneven wearing on the soles of your shoes, replace them right away.

Excess Weight

TIP! Developing a solid plan is integral for your arthritis. These plans will enable you to respond to arthritis symptoms, which can vary from day to day.

Excess weight causes pain and inflammation associated with arthritis. Excess weight will increase joint strain and can lead to flareups. Losing weight may reduce the rates and intensity of occurrences; dropping pounds might be just what is needed.

Consult your doctor about using heat and/or cold treatments on your ailing joints. Ice packs and heating pads will help to reduce the pressure and pain that you feel from arthritis. You can also benefit from alternating between the heat and the cold, don't overuse this method.

TIP! Quitting smoking can serve as a huge benefit to your health, as it will reduce the swelling and irritation from arthritis. Research has shown that smokers tend to have more problems with their joints as well as more pain related to arthritis than their nonsmoking counterparts.
